Frequently asked questions
- Is acrylates/ammonium methacrylate copolymer safe during pregnancy?
- No harmonised CLP reproductive classification for acrylates/ammonium methacrylate copolymer (ECHA Annex VI contains no H360/H361 listings for this polymer), no CIR or SCCS safety assessments indicating reproductive hazard, and no peer‑reviewed reproductive toxicity data indicating teratogenicity — polymeric film‑formers are generally high‑molecular‑weight with negligible systemic availability (sources: ECHA Annex VI, CIR, PubMed/CosIng/PubChem data).
- Is acrylates/ammonium methacrylate copolymer safe while breastfeeding?
- Same rationale as pregnancy: no harmonised or authoritative safety flags, lack of animal or human data showing lactation/transfer concerns, and expected minimal dermal absorption for high molecular weight acrylate copolymers used as film‑formers (sources: CIR, CosIng, PubChem, no relevant PubMed reproductive/lactation studies identified).
- Is acrylates/ammonium methacrylate copolymer safe for baby skin?
- Hazard and mechanism: no evidence of reproductive or endocrine activity in the literature or regulatory assessments. Exposure: adult dermal absorption is negligible for this high‑molecular‑weight polymer, but infant skin has higher permeability and surface‑area‑to‑weight, so exposure score increased by +1 for 0–3 yr (adult e=0 → baby e=1). No infant‑specific toxicity data found (sources: CIR, CosIng, PubChem, PubMed).
